    Right, Have an Aiwa CTR429M Radio and 6 CD changer for my car (00 VW Polo 1.4)

    Now heres is one of the first obsticles I have noticed.

    The Radio Antenna Connector Is different on the new radio to the old one.
    The old One is an L type connector (in that it folders in an L shaped Mannner) where as the Aiwa port is straight.

    Usually the L shaped bit is just a stick on adapter. It should just pull off to leave the standard straight one. The pic looks a bit blurry bit if its not removeable an adapter should be easy to pick up.

    As stekelly says all you need is an adapter. There are various adapters available to fit allsorts of antenna connections. Most car audio/alarm installers will have these available.
